The New Harmony Historic District is a captivating blend of history and culture, inviting tourists to explore its unique architecture, lush gardens, and rich heritage. This charming location, nestled in Indiana, serves as a living testament to the utopian communities of the 19th century, showcasing beautifully preserved buildings and vibrant public spaces that make it a must-visit destination for history enthusiasts and casual travelers alike.

Local tips
- Visit during one of the local festivals for a lively experience of art, music, and community spirit.
- Take a guided tour to gain deeper insights into the historical significance of the area.
- Don’t miss the opportunity to explore the gardens; they are a perfect spot for relaxation and photography.
- Check out the local shops for unique handcrafted souvenirs that reflect the town's artistic heritage.
- Plan your visit on weekdays to enjoy a quieter experience and have more personal interactions with local artisans.
